

Sobrevivência na Amazônia
Description
Explorers parachutes into the Amazonia Forest with a mission. They have to explore the forest while moving towards the rescue point inside the jungle. On their way they have to collect food, water and others resources to survive.
Every four rounds day turns into night and all players have to mount camp. Each movement is made based on a choice from three directions - forwards, left or right - that will lead into different areas of the jungle. The options are represented by event cards (that can be either river or forest).
Full moon nights trigger magical happenings in the forest that are revealed by special cards dealt individually to each player.
On the way you can photograph animals at risk of extinction and expose situations that harm the forest life. These forest-aiding actions give extra bonuses.
The first player to arrive at the rescue point receives extra bonus points and declares the last round of the game. The game winner is the player who helped the forest the most and survived well, gathering victory points in resources collected and good actions made.
